Top definition
1. the stimulation of ones own ego for self gratifiacation via a wecast

2. one who is a narcissistic (and possibly an exhibitionist) fucktard that desperately engages in the activity of lifecasting

verb form of one who casterbates
Aaron- Did you see that jerk off life casting on Justin TV last night?

Mike- Yeah, he was a total casterbator.
by DL33t! September 08, 2009
Get the mug
Get a casterbator mug for your friend Jerry.